#7462c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7462c2 is composed of 45.5% red, 38.4%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 49.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 251.3 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 57.3%. #7462c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8c4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

● #7462c2 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#7462c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7462c2 has RGB values of R:116, G:98,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 7627458.

Shades and Tints of #7462c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06050d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.
